Kinds Of Aluminium Doors and Windows
Aluminium windows and doors been available in different styles and performance, each suited to various requirements and choices. The following are some common types:
Aluminium Doors
- Sliding Doors: Perfect for spaces where you wish to optimize natural light without compromising performance.
- Bi-Folding Doors: These doors fold back to produce a seamless shift between indoor and outdoor spaces, suitable for outdoor patios and decks.
- French Doors: Offering a classic appearance, these doors include beauty and beauty while enabling plentiful light.
- Hinged Doors: Traditional in design, hinged doors are available in numerous setups and sizes.
Aluminium Windows
- Casement Windows: These are hinged at the side and open outward, supplying great ventilation and unblocked views.
- Sliding Windows: With horizontal sliding sashes, these windows are easy to operate and ideal for areas with minimal wall space.
- Fixed Windows: Designed to stay fixed, set windows provide a clear view and let in natural light.
- Awning Windows: Hinged at the top, these windows open outside, permitting ventilation even throughout rain.
Maintenance of Aluminium Doors and Windows
While aluminium windows and doors are low-maintenance, a few easy practices can help lengthen their life-span and keep them looking new. Here's an upkeep list:
Maintenance Checklist
Regular Cleaning:
- Use mild cleaning agent and water to clean the frames and glass.
- Guarantee that dirt and particles are regularly gotten rid of from rail tracks and hinges.
Inspect Seals:
- Check the seals and gaskets annually for wear and tear.
- Replace any damaged seals to maintain energy performance.
Oil Moving Parts:
- Lubricate hinges, locks, and rollers to ensure smooth operation and avoid rust.
Look for Corrosion:
- Look for any indications of deterioration, specifically in seaside areas, and attend to any problems immediately.
Expert Servicing:
- Consider having a professional check and service your windows and doors every few years to keep peak efficiency.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Are aluminium doors and windows more expensive than wood?
While the preliminary expense of aluminium alternatives may be higher, their durability and low upkeep can lead to cost savings in the long run.
2. Can aluminium doors and windows be painted?
Yes, aluminium can be painted, however it's a good idea to utilize an unique exterior-grade paint designed for metal surface areas.
3. How do aluminium windows compare with PVC windows in terms of energy performance?
Both aluminium and PVC windows can be energy effective, however aluminium windows with thermal breaks offer superior insulation compared to standard PVC alternatives.
4. Are aluminium windows and doors vulnerable to condensation?
While aluminium can experience condensation, using thermal breaks and double glazing significantly lowers the risk.
5. What colors are offered for aluminium windows and doors?
Aluminium doors and windows can be powder-coated in essentially any color, supplying homeowners with comprehensive personalization options.
